Rezumat

Business demography allows the performance of businesses in the economy to be measured. Understanding the processes and dynamics underlying the creation, survival, and death of businesses can provide important insight into business behavior, and the mechanisms for generating new jobs and ensuring better economic development at national and regional levels. The analysis of the enterprises’ birth and death events provides the necessary information on the challenges faced by enterprises and implicitly represents a basis for entrepreneurship development. The purpose of the undertaken research is to analyze the available indicators of the enterprises’ demography in the Republic of Moldova for the period 2016-2020 at the national and regional levels. Research techniques are based on secondary data analysis, comparison, grouping, chain indices, dynamic series, and figures. The results indicate a negative dynamic of the population of enterprises in recent years, with an average death rate of enterprises, which exceeds the birth enterprises rate.
